#c17158 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c17158 is composed of 75.7% red, 44.3%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 41.5% magenta, 54.4%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 14.3 degrees, a saturation of 45.9% and a lightness of 55.1%. #c17158 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e2b0 with #830000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#c17158 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c17158 has RGB values of R:193, G:113,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.41, Y:0.54,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 12677464.

Shades and Tints of #c17158
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050202 is the darkest color, while #fbf7f5 is the lightest one.
